Output 5ba5668bd8205b11259d428e2cc3248ae3c665b51f77fdf02dc6abfce9e55e00:0

value
66854
script pubkey
OP_0 OP_PUSHBYTES_20 52f4abdcd280e446853ced767b15a5991b70cfaf
address
bc1q2t62hhxjsrjydpfua4m8k9d9nydhpna0qflzsn
transaction
5ba5668bd8205b11259d428e2cc3248ae3c665b51f77fdf02dc6abfce9e55e00
confirmations
1253
spent
true